Roles and Responsibilities
Jay Heiser is a VP analyst and the Chief of Research for the ITL Security and Risk Management team. Mr. Heiser's recent areas of research include digital business risks, Cloud risks, and SaaS governance. His most recent research examines the international implications of the public cloud computing business model.

Previous Experience
Mr. Heiser's background includes several software product management roles involving encryption, secure messaging, antivirus and secure UNIX software. As a consultant, he has performed security assessments for major corporations, multinational internet service providers and the US Department of Defense, as well as writing information security policies for both UBS and Credit Suisse. Co-author of the book "Computer Forensics: Incident Response Fundamentals," he was a columnist for Information Security magazine for 10 years.
